A Special Education teaching position is available for grades K-12 in Caldwell, ID. This contract role begins in January 2026 and concludes in June 2026. The position offers a work schedule of 30 to 37.5 hours per week, five days per week, providing direct instruction and support to students in self-contained, resource, and special day classrooms.
